## Configuration

Welcome aboard. RateVault is the tax-rate lookup cache used by the Marloch billing pipeline. It warms itself from the upstream Fennwick rates service on startup, then serves lookups from memory with a six-hour TTL. Copy `env.sample` to `.env` and review the region, TTL, and eviction settings — defaults are fine for staging. The cache cannot warm without credentials for the Fennwick service, so the upstream API secret must be set on the line immediately following this paragraph.

env line for fahag-fafop: LEDGER_TOKEN3=815

## 2.9.1 — Key rotation for TileFetch prefetcher

Rotated the signing key used by the TileFetch map-tile prefetcher after the quarterly audit at Norwich Dynamics flagged the old one as past its expiry window. All prefetch manifests built after this release are signed with the new key. On-call: if tile verification alarms fire, confirm the edge nodes trust the following.

rollout seal: bky4_x7Gc

Action item (PM-1142, Ledgerline export OOM). Owner: platform team. The XLSX exporter buffered whole sheets in memory; a crafted 900-column template drove heap past the pod limit and crashed co-tenant jobs — a denial-of-service vector worth your review. Fix: streaming writer with hard row/column caps and a per-export memory budget enforced before render. Caps are config-pinned and change-controlled. The enforced limits now read as follows.

limits module of tawep-kahif:
THRESHOLDS = {
    "belion": 47,
    "oliius": 142,
    "quenok": 982,
    "fraeth": 230,
    "ralmir": 303,
    "praeth": 969,
    "raliel": 440,
}

Minutes — management meeting, Brightholm pilot churn review. Present: finance leads and programme office. Churn in the Brightholm pilot sits at 11%, driven mainly by month-two cancellations. Refund exposure is within reserve; Finance to model a revised forecast by month end. Agreed actions: tighten onboarding, pause new enrolments in underperforming districts, and rework the incentive accrual schedule. Next review in three weeks, chaired by Odile Fenwright. A confidential business-plan note follows below.

confidential, kagep-kahof: Druokax Systems plans to lower the Ulaath list price by 53 percent in March.